Score Interpretation

How to read your total maturity score (0 to 100).

1 to 20: Struggling. Planning is not producing a plan. The team leaves without a goal, without ready work, and without a shared view of capacity, so the sprint is decided during the sprint.

21 to 40: Developing. The meeting happens on schedule but the inputs are weak. Stories arrive oversized and unclear, commitment is based on optimism, and dependencies surface after the sprint has already started.

41 to 60: Norming. The basics hold. The right people attend, the backlog is mostly ready, and a goal usually gets set. The next gains come from sizing commitment against real data and reserving capacity for the work that always shows up.

61 to 80: Performing. Planning produces a plan the team believes. Stories are split, the Definition of Done is applied, dependencies are named, and the team pulls its own work. Tune confidence checks and retrospective follow through.

81 to 100: Thriving. Planning is a genuine advantage. The team commits to a goal it can defend, sized against its own history, with technical debt and dependencies accounted for before day one.

Team Size

What is the number of team members including the Scrum Master, Product Owner, and Tech Lead?

Why it matters: Sprint Planning is a negotiation about capacity and scope, and both get harder to hold in one conversation as the group grows. Six to nine people is the range where everyone can speak to the work and the team can still reach genuine agreement inside a timebox. Below six, you usually lack a skill needed to finish a story end to end, so commitments depend on someone outside the team. Above twelve, most attendees disengage and a small subset plans on everyone else’s behalf.

To improve your score: If you are at thirteen or more, look hard at whether you are running two teams from one backlog. Split them, give each its own goal and its own planning session, and let each build its own velocity history. If you are under six, confirm you have every skill needed to reach done without a handoff, and either add that skill or plan explicitly around the dependency instead of pretending it is not there.

Attendance

How many people were in attendance?

Why it matters: Team size sets the ceiling, attendance tells you what actually happened. People who miss planning did not agree to the commitment, did not hear the goal, and did not raise the risk they could see. They then get handed work they never sized. Very high attendance is its own signal, usually meaning managers and adjacent teams are observing, which makes the team perform rather than plan honestly.

To improve your score: Treat planning as the one session with no optional attendees for the delivery team, and reschedule rather than plan without a core skill in the room. Track attendance for four sprints and look for the pattern instead of reacting to one bad week. If observers are inflating the count, ask them to attend the demo instead, where their input is actually useful.

Roles Present

Who was present?

Why it matters: Planning needs three perspectives simultaneously: someone who owns the why and can decide scope, someone who can say how hard the work really is, and someone who keeps the session on time and on purpose. Without the Product Owner, the team guesses at intent and commits to its own interpretation. Without the Tech Lead and engineers, estimates are wishful. Without the Scrum Master, one story consumes the hour.

To improve your score: Publish a short required versus optional list and hold to it. Give each role a job in the session: the Product Owner states the goal and answers scope questions, the Tech Lead flags technical risk and dependencies, the Scrum Master runs the timebox and captures decisions. Name a backup for each role so a single absence does not force you to plan without a perspective.

Facilitation

Who facilitated?

Why it matters: Whoever facilitates shapes what the session optimizes for. A Scrum Master who facilitates keeps the trade off between scope and capacity in the open and makes sure the quietest engineer gets to voice a concern. When the Product Owner facilitates, planning tends to drift toward filling the sprint. When the Tech Lead facilitates, it tends to drift toward technical design. When nobody owns it, the session becomes a walk through the backlog with no decision at the end.

To improve your score: Give the Scrum Master explicit ownership of facilitation so the Product Owner can focus on value and the Tech Lead on feasibility. Use a repeatable flow: confirm capacity, propose a goal, pull and size stories against that goal, surface dependencies, then confirm commitment. Name a backup facilitator in advance and have them run one session per quarter so the skill is not held by one person.

Cameras On

Were cameras on?

Why it matters: Commitment depends on doubt surfacing before the sprint starts, not after. Cameras are how a facilitator catches the hesitation when someone accepts a story they do not understand, or the look that says the estimate is optimistic. Audio only planning hides that, and silence gets recorded as agreement. Camera off sessions also make multitasking easy, and a distracted team will accept whatever scope is proposed.

To improve your score: Set a team norm for cameras on during planning and explain the reason rather than just stating the rule. Keep the session tight enough that being on camera is reasonable. If people consistently opt out, find out what is driving it, whether that is meeting load, home setup, or discomfort, and solve that instead of repeating the request. In person sessions satisfy this automatically.

Session Length

How long did the meeting last?

Why it matters: Thirty to sixty minutes is the range where a well prepared team can set a goal, pull work, and check capacity with real attention. A session much shorter than that usually means the team accepted a pre built sprint without questioning it. A session past an hour usually means the backlog was not ready and planning turned into refinement, or the team is designing solutions instead of committing to outcomes.

To improve your score: Timebox planning and protect the inputs that make the timebox realistic, which means a refined backlog and a known capacity number before the meeting starts. When one story consumes the timebox, treat that as data: it is too large or too vague, so split it or leave it out of the sprint. Move deep technical design into a follow up session with only the people who need to be there.

Backlog Visibility

Was the backlog visible for user stories to be added to the upcoming sprint?

Why it matters: If the backlog is not on the screen, the team is planning from memory and from whatever one person narrates. Nothing gets updated in the tool during the session, so decisions live in someone’s head and the sprint board does not match what the team agreed. A visible backlog also keeps priority honest, because everyone can see what is being left out and can challenge it in the moment.

To improve your score: Share the backlog at the start of every session and move items into the sprint live as the team commits to them. Assign a scribe so estimates, notes, and open questions land on the story before the group moves on. If your tool is too slow to work in live, fix that friction first, because it quietly pushes the team back toward planning from memory.

Backlog Readiness

Was the backlog ready?

Why it matters: Readiness is the single biggest predictor of whether planning produces a real commitment. When stories arrive without clear outcomes, acceptance criteria, or sizing, planning becomes refinement under time pressure and the team commits to work it does not understand yet. Those stories are the ones that stall mid sprint and reappear as carryover.

To improve your score: Hold a separate weekly refinement session so readiness is built before planning rather than during it. Agree on a short Definition of Ready, usually five to seven checks, and let the team decline anything that does not meet it. Give the Product Owner a standing expectation that the top of the backlog is prepared two days before planning, which leaves time to close gaps rather than discovering them live.

Story Splitting

Are large or unclear stories split into smaller, well-defined pieces before the team commits to them during planning?

Why it matters: Oversized stories are how sprints fail quietly. A story that spans most of the sprint hides risk, blocks parallel work, and produces a board where everything is in progress and nothing is done. Teams that do not split end up measuring partial credit, which makes velocity meaningless and makes forecasting impossible.

To improve your score: Adopt a shared splitting vocabulary so the team has moves to reach for: split by workflow step, by business rule, by happy path versus error handling, by data variation, or by interface versus logic. Set a rule of thumb that a story should be finishable in a few days by one or two people, and treat anything larger as a splitting candidate before it enters the sprint. Practice on one oversized story per session until it becomes reflex.

Sprint Goals

Did the team identify one or more Sprint Goals?

Why it matters: A sprint without a goal is a list of tickets, and a list gives the team no basis for deciding what to do when something goes wrong mid sprint. The goal is what lets a team drop a low value story to protect the outcome, and what lets a stakeholder understand the sprint in one sentence. Teams without goals tend to measure success by how many points closed, which is not the same as delivering something valuable.

To improve your score: Write one goal per sprint as an outcome a customer or stakeholder would recognize, not as a summary of the tickets. Propose the goal before pulling stories so scope follows purpose rather than the reverse. Post it on the board, reference it at the daily standup, and open the demo with it so the team sees the goal used rather than filed away.

Ready Work Depth

How many sprints are refined and ready in the backlog?

Why it matters: Depth of ready work is what makes planning fast and low stress. Less than a sprint of ready work means every planning session starts with a scramble and the team commits to whatever is closest to ready rather than what is most valuable. Very deep refinement has its own cost, because detailed stories that sit for months get rewritten before anyone builds them, and that rework is invisible waste.

To improve your score: Aim for roughly two sprints of ready work and check the number at the end of every refinement session so it becomes something the team manages on purpose. If you are running thin, spend the next two refinement sessions building breadth instead of perfecting the top story. If you are over refined, stop detailing beyond the second sprint and let items further out stay coarse.

Definition of Done Check

Does the team check candidate stories against a shared Definition of Done before committing to them in planning?

Why it matters: A commitment only means something if everyone agrees what done means. When the Definition of Done is not applied at planning, teams size the coding and forget the testing, documentation, review, and deployment that the same story requires. That is why work looks finished on day eight and is still open on day ten. It is also how quality debt accumulates without anyone deciding to take it on.

To improve your score: Put the Definition of Done on screen during planning and read it against the stories the team is about to pull, asking specifically what each item requires for testing, review, and release. Keep it short enough to be usable, usually six to ten checks. When the team repeatedly cannot meet an item, that is a signal to fix the underlying constraint rather than to quietly drop the check.

Product Owner Engagement

Is the Product Owner present and actively answering questions throughout sprint planning?

Why it matters: Presence is not the same as engagement. A Product Owner who attends but does not answer questions leaves the team to guess at scope, and those guesses become rework. Planning generates the highest density of scope questions in the whole sprint, and every question that goes unanswered in the room becomes a blocker later, usually on the day the work was supposed to finish.

To improve your score: Give the Product Owner an active role in the session rather than an opening statement, which means staying for the full timebox and making scope calls live. Track how many questions get parked with no answer and review that count with them. If they are stretched across multiple teams, agree on a fixed planning slot and protect it, and give the team a named delegate with real decision authority for the rare miss.

Story Assignment

How were user stories or tasks assigned to team members for completion?

Why it matters: Who chooses the work determines who owns it. Self assignment produces commitment, spreads knowledge, and lets the team reshuffle when priorities shift. Assignment by a manager, Scrum Master, or Product Owner produces compliance, hides capacity problems, and quietly creates a set of individual queues instead of a team plan. Leaving work unassigned is the other failure, because a story nobody has picked up is a story nobody is watching.

To improve your score: Let the team pull work in priority order during planning rather than distributing it. Pair on the stories only one person can do, and treat every one of those as a cross training target so the concentration does not persist. If someone is assigning work, name the reason directly, because it is usually either low trust or unclear priority, and both are addressable.

Sprint Length

How long are the team’s sprints?

Why it matters: Sprint length sets your feedback interval. Two weeks is the common sweet spot because it is long enough to finish meaningful work and short enough that a bad plan costs you ten days, not a month. One week sprints raise the overhead of planning and demo relative to the work done and punish any story that cannot be split small. Three weeks or longer delays feedback so much that the plan is usually stale before it ends, and carryover becomes normal.

To improve your score: If you are running three weeks or more, move to two and use the change as a forcing function for smaller stories, since work that will not fit is a splitting problem rather than a length problem. Keep the length fixed for at least a quarter so velocity data stays comparable. If you are at one week and planning feels rushed, two weeks will usually buy back the time without slowing feedback much.

Velocity Based Commitment

Does the team size its sprint commitment against actual historical velocity rather than gut feel?

Why it matters: Commitment made on gut feel is systematically optimistic, because teams plan for the sprint where nothing goes wrong. Historical velocity is the correction. Without it, the team overcommits, carries work over, and then treats carryover as normal, which destroys the credibility of every forecast it gives. Velocity is not a productivity target, it is a capacity signal that keeps the plan honest.

To improve your score: Use the average of your last three to six sprints as the starting number and adjust it down for known absences, holidays, and support duty. Say the number out loud at the start of planning and stop pulling when you reach it. Count only work that met the Definition of Done, since counting partial credit inflates the number and hides the problem. If your team does not use points, count completed stories instead, which works fine once stories are consistently small.

Dependency Identification

Are cross-team or external dependencies identified and discussed during sprint planning, before the sprint begins?

Why it matters: Dependencies discovered mid sprint are one of the most reliable ways a sprint goal slips. Planning is the last cheap moment to find them, because there is still time to resequence the work, start the conversation with the other team, or split the story so the part you control can move on schedule. Once the sprint is running, your plan is hostage to somebody else’s queue.

To improve your score: Make dependency a standing question on every story pulled into the sprint: does this need another team, a vendor, an approval, data, or an environment we do not control? Record the dependency with a named contact and the date you need it by. For anything unresolved at planning, either sequence it later or split out the independent part, and never commit to a story whose external input has not been confirmed.

Technical Debt Capacity

Does the team reserve a portion of its sprint capacity for technical debt and defect work rather than planning at full feature capacity?

Why it matters: Defects and maintenance arrive whether or not you planned for them. A team that fills the sprint entirely with features either drops the goal to handle a production issue or lets debt compound until velocity falls for reasons nobody can point to. Reserving capacity makes that cost visible and turns it into a decision rather than a surprise.

To improve your score: Set an explicit reserve, commonly ten to twenty percent of capacity, and agree with the Product Owner what it covers. Look at what unplanned work actually consumed over the last few sprints and use that as your starting number rather than a guess. Keep a short prioritized list of debt items so the reserve gets spent on the highest leverage fix instead of whatever is nearest, and report on it at the demo so the investment stays visible to stakeholders.

Retrospective Follow Through

Are action items from the previous Sprint Retrospective referenced or addressed during sprint planning?

Why it matters: Retrospective actions that never reach planning do not happen. The team names the same problem every two weeks, watches nothing change, and gradually stops raising real issues, which is how a retrospective becomes theater. Connecting the two events is what turns improvement from an intention into work with capacity behind it.

To improve your score: Pick one or two improvement actions per sprint, no more, and give each a named owner and a visible place on the sprint board rather than a line in meeting notes. Open planning by reviewing the previous actions and stating plainly whether each was done. If an item survives two sprints untouched, either fund it properly with capacity or drop it and say why, because carrying it silently is worse than either.

Confidence Check

Does the team do an explicit confidence check or gut-check vote on its sprint commitment before planning closes?

Why it matters: Without an explicit check, silence gets recorded as agreement and the people with doubts carry them privately into the sprint. A confidence vote takes two minutes and surfaces the disagreement while it is still free to act on. It also gives the Scrum Master a concrete signal to work with, because a plan the team rates as low confidence is a plan that needs scope removed, not encouragement.

To improve your score: Close every planning session with a simple vote, such as a show of five fingers or a thumbs signal, on whether the team believes it can meet the goal. Ask anyone below the midpoint what would raise their confidence, and act on the answer before the session ends by cutting scope, splitting a story, or resolving a dependency. Record the number and compare it against what actually happened, which teaches the team to read its own signal accurately.

Sprint Demo Discussion

Was the sprint demo discussed?

Why it matters: Talking about the demo during planning forces the team to describe what a stakeholder will actually see at the end of the sprint. That question exposes commitments that are technically real but have no visible outcome, and it catches the case where every story is backend work and there is nothing to show. Teams that skip it often reach demo day and assemble a story afterward.

To improve your score: Spend the last five minutes of planning naming what will be demonstrated, who will present each piece, and which stakeholders should be there. If the answer is that nothing will be visible, revisit the plan and pull at least one item that produces a demonstrable outcome. Capture that list on the sprint board so preparing for the demo is part of the work rather than a scramble the morning of.
